Personal injury law serves as a safeguard for individuals who have suffered harm or injury due to the negligence or wrongdoing of others. It provides:

  • A framework for seeking justice.
  • Holding responsible parties accountable.
  • Obtaining compensation for the damages incurred.

In a world where accidents and unforeseen events disrupt lives, personal injury law is crucial in advocating for victims and ensuring their rights are upheld. This article explores how personal injury law protects and advocates for you in distress.

Establishing Accountability: Personal injury law establishes a foundation of accountability. When individuals or entities fail to exercise reasonable care, leading to harm, personal injury law enables victims to hold them responsible for their actions or negligence. This accountability promotes safer behavior and encourages individuals to consider the well-being of others.

Seeking Compensation for Damages: Injury-causing incidents often result in various damages, including med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and emotional distress. Personal injury law enables victims to seek compensation for these damages, helping them recover financially from the impact of the injury.

Negotiating with Insurance Companies: Navigating insurance claims can be complex and overwhelming, especially when dealing with adjusters and complex policies. Personal injury lawyers are the best at negotiating with insurance to ensure that victims receive fair and just compensation, relieving them of the burden of dealing with insurers directly.

Advocating for Fair Settlements: Experienced personal injury lawyers advocate for their client’s best interests, striving for fair settlements that adequately reflect the extent of the injuries and damages suffered. Their expertise ensures that victims are not exploited during the negotiation process.

Navigating Legal Procedures: The legal procedures involved in personal injury cases can be daunting for individuals already grappling with the aftermath of an injury. Personal injury attorneys guide victims through every step, from gathering evidence and filing paperwork to representing them in negotiations or trials.

Ensuring Due Process: Personal injury law guarantees victims their day in court, providing an avenue to seek justice when a fair settlement cannot be reached. This ensures that victims’ stories are heard and their rights are upheld, regardless of the size or influence of the opposing party.

Fostering Deterrence: Personal injury law promotes a safer society by promoting deterrence. When individuals and entities recognize the consequences of negligence or harmful actions, they are more likely to take preventive measures and exercise caution to avoid causing harm.

Promoting Empowerment: In times of distress, personal injury law empowers victims by giving them a voice and the means to seek compensation for their losses. This empowerment helps victims regain control over their lives and their recovery trajectory.
